Reviewers on SDC consistently describe Friction Parties' hotel-takeover events as high-energy, well-organized, and welcoming to both newcomers and lifestyle veterans. Recurring themes include a "sexy," festive atmosphere with themed nights, DJs, and dance floors, praise for the crowd being friendly and respectful rather than pushy, and repeat attendance — several reviewers mention having gone to multiple Friction events over one or more years and returning specifically because of the vibe and organization.
The most consistent friction point across reviews isn't about the organizers themselves but about venue-specific logistics: at least one reviewer flagged disappointment when a particular hotel takeover lost pool access, calling it "a big deal" since the pool is normally part of the pre-party socializing. No safety, scam, or management complaints turned up in the public review text read.

Friction Parties is a women-owned and operated event company founded more than 22 years ago by Lisa Friction, billed as the only nationally recognized hotel party brand in the United States. Operating across the East Coast — with events regularly held in the Washington DC/Maryland area, Philadelphia, New Jersey, North Carolina, and Ohio — Friction takes over entire hotels for the duration of each event, meaning every guest and room belongs exclusively to the lifestyle community. The organizing ethos is welcoming but selective: the crowd skews toward what organizers describe as attractive, well-groomed couples and single women, and all attendees are pre-screened before admission. Events run in two formats. Single-day events are typically held on Saturdays around themed holidays — Halloween, New Year’s Eve, Valentine’s Day, St. Patrick’s Day — with check-in from 2 PM and a ballroom dance party running from 9 PM to around 1:30 AM. Weekend two-day events add clothing-optional pool parties and afternoon activities. Ticket prices range from approximately $75–$150 per person; no refunds, only future-event credits. Membership on the platform lets members browse event attendee lists and connect with couples and single females year-round. Once the main dance party ends, the format shifts to an informal hall crawl on a designated party floor where room doors are propped open and guests host themed mini-parties until the early morning. The ballroom features a DJ, dance poles, cages, and themed décor matched to the night’s costume theme. Alcohol is available via full cash bar operated by the hotel; guests may not bring drinks from rooms to the party floor.
